Wayland unfortunately couldn't capitalize on their home-field advantage in their season opener. They took a 14-0 bruising from the Holliston Panthers on Friday. The Warriors were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Panthers apparently hadn't forgotten their loss the last time these teams played back in April of 2021.
Austin Rodenhiser had a dynamite game For Holliston., rushing for 213 yards and one TD while picking up 7.9 yards per carry. Rodenhiser was no stranger to the big play, turning on the jets for a run that went for 56 yards.
Wayland has already played their next contest, a 32-28 defeat against Hopkinton on the 12th. As for Holliston,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next match, a 28-12 loss against Lincoln-Sudbury on the 12th.
